The Royal Castle of Ciergnon or Ciergnon Castle is a residence and summer retreat of the Belgian royal family situated near the town of Ciergnon in the municipality of Houyet, Namur Province, Wallonia. The castle is a property of the Belgian Royal Trust.

Villers-sur-Lesse is a village of Wallonia and a district of the municipality of Rochefort, located in the province of Namur, Belgium. In the Middle Ages, the village was a small fief, held by a vassal of the Prince-Bishop of Liège.
